Iv had some success of the breakwall on windang beach where lake illawarra emptys out so you can try there, the chanels around the entrance of the lake (near windang bridge) are allright for flatties n bream and if all else fails Id recomend going to tallawarra power station and chucking in in the hot water chanel on the right hand side, theres heaps of smaller bream there so you will be getting constant bites with the chance of scoring some legal bream and flatties, hope that helps some good luck to ya n merry x-mas
